Audio dubbing

(SLV-SE800D1/D2/E and SX800D only)

This feature lets you record over the normal audio track. The monaural sound previously recorded is replaced while the original hi-fi sound remains unchanged. Use this feature to add commentary to a tape that you have recorded with a camcorder.

1 Insert a source tape into your stereo system (or the playback VCR). Search for the point to start playback and set it to playback pause.

2 Insert a prerecorded tape with its safety tab in place into this (recording) VCR. Search for the start of the section to be replaced and press X(pause).

The VCR enters pause mode.

3 Press AUDIO DUB.

The programme position changes to “L2,” and the indicator appears in the display window.
